色差仪是一种用于测量物体颜色的仪器,它可以将物体的颜色转化为各种颜色空间中的数值,其中最常用的颜色空间是Lab颜色空间。因此,了解Lab颜色空间和Lab值的计算公式对于使用色差仪进行颜色测量具有重要意义。
一、Lab颜色空间
Lab颜色空间是一种国际标准颜色空间,它由三个坐标表示:L、a和b。其中,L表示亮度坐标,取值范围为[0, 100],表示颜色的明暗程度;a表示红绿坐标,取值范围为[-120, 120],表示颜色的红色和绿色程度;b表示黄蓝坐标,取值范围为[-120, 120],表示颜色的黄色和蓝色程度。
二、Lab值的计算公式
在色差仪中,测量物体颜色的过程是将物体表面的颜色转化为Lab颜色空间中的数值。具体来说,色差仪首先将物体表面的颜色分解为红、绿、蓝三种基色,然后分别测量这三种基色的亮度值和色相角度,最后根据这些测量值计算出Lab值。
1. RGB值的计算
色差仪首先通过光学系统将物体表面的颜色分解为红、绿、蓝三种基色,并使用光电转换器件将这三种基色的亮度信号转换为相应的电信号。设三种基色的亮度信号为R、G、B,则可得到以下计算公式:
R=r(L)cosθcosγ
G=g(L)cosθcosβ
B=b(L)cosθcosα
其中,r、g、b分别为红、绿、蓝三种基色的色度坐标;L为物体的亮度;θ为色相角;γ、β、α分别为红、绿、蓝三种基色的色相角。
2. Lab值的计算
根据前面所述的Lab颜色空间中坐标的定义,我们可以将RGB值转换为Lab值。具体计算公式如下:
L=116×[f(Y/Yn)]3-16×f(Y/Yn)+0.353×(116×[f(Y/Yn)]3-16×f(Y/Yn))×[(a/500)+0.147]×[(b/500)-0.298]
a=500×[f(X/Xn)-f(Y/Yn)]-116×[f(Y/Yn)]3+16×f(Y/Yn)-16×f(X/Xn)×f(Y/Yn)×[f(Y/Yn)-f(X/Xn)]
b=500×[f(X/Xn)-f(Y/Yn)]+21×f(Y/Yn)-353×f(X/Xn)×f(Y/Yn)×[f(X/Xn)-f(Y/Yn)]
其中,X、Y、Z分别为标准白光的三刺激值;Xn、Yn、Zn分别为标准白光的色度坐标;f(X/Xn)、f(Y/Yn)、f(Z/Zn)分别为RGB值与三刺激值的转换函数。
Copyright © 2024 深圳市三恩驰科技有限公司 版权所有 备案号: 粤ICP备13073186号